Lucknow, Sep 1: A student has died under suspicious circumstances at Ram Manohar Lohia National Law University in Lucknow. The body of 19-year-old Anika Rastogi was found lying on the floor in her hostel room, prompting immediate action from authorities.
Anika Rastogi, a third-year LLB student, was the daughter of IPS officer Santosh Rastogi, who serves as IG at NIA Delhi. The police arrived quickly after receiving the report and sealed the hostel room. Rastogi was taken to the hospital in an unconscious state but was declared dead upon arrival.
The cause of Anika Rastogi’s death remains unclear. The Ashiana police have sent the body for a postmortem examination. It is reported that when Rastogi did not open her room door at night, her friends broke in and transported her to the hospital. The investigation into her death is ongoing.
